The 'Lulworth Crumple' visible here demonstrates intense tectonic folding from 30 million years ago.
The sea arches are formed by the sea breaking through the hard Portland limestone outer layer to reach softer clays behind it.
Stair Hole is part of the Dorset and East Devon Coast UNESCO World Heritage Site.
The alternating bands of rock represent different geological periods, ranging from the Jurassic to the Cretaceous.
The site illustrates the process of how a sea cave eventually collapses to form a cove.
Stair Hole is a small cove located on the Jurassic Coast featuring significant geological folding known as the Lulworth Crumple. The site showcases complex limestone rock formations, sea caves, and natural arches created by wave erosion. Unlike the adjacent Lulworth Cove, Stair Hole is smaller and characterized by its visible layers of Portland and Purbeck limestone. The cove serves as a natural laboratory for observing how different rock strata react to marine erosion. It is part of the Lulworth Estate and is protected for its scientific importance.
